Yes, parking is available on-site for a fee of PLN 140 per day. Reservations are not required.
Cooked-to-order breakfasts are available daily from 6:30 AM to 10:30 AM for a fee of approximately PLN 119 for adults and PLN 49.5 for children.
Yes, pets are allowed with a fee of PLN 120 per accommodation, per night. Service animals are exempt from fees.
Check-in is from 2:00 PM until 11:59 PM, and check-out is at 12:00 PM. Early or late check-in/check-out may be available upon request and could incur additional charges.
Yes, airport shuttle services are available for a fee of PLN 120 per vehicle (maximum occupancy 4). Guests must contact the property 48 hours prior to arrival to arrange the transfer.
The property offers limited wheelchair accessibility, including step-free entrances and wheelchair-accessible facilities in public areas. However, specific details regarding room accessibility should be confirmed directly with the property.
The property is centrally located in Warsaw, within a 10-minute walk of Rondo 1 Conference Centre and Nozyk Synagogue. It is approximately 0.3 mi from Hala Mirowska and 0.4 mi from the Museum of Modern Art in Warsaw.
One child 6 years old or younger stays free when occupying the parent or guardian's room, using existing bedding.
Rollaway beds are available for a fee of PLN 160 per night. Guests should request confirmation for availability directly with the property.
